EX-3 Rec PSF and Remove Pulldown
I have read the manual over and can't wrap myself around when and when not to use these settings for 1080 30p 1080 24p to edit in FCP. When the EX-3 is in 24P the Record Progressive is invoked automatically, but not in 30p. When would I remove the 3:2 pulldown and why? Sorry to be so lost. Does someone have a simple explanation to keep all this straight?
|
If your camera is set to record 24p but the SDI signal coming from your camera is 60i, then you would want to use 3:2 pulldown removal to get the original 24p frames from the 60i signal.
Hopefully that makes sense and keeps it simple for you. |

24psf on EX1 vs 60i on EX3
Just to confuse matters -- the last time I looked, the latest firmware versions for the EX1 give you a menu option to output 24psf through the HD-SDI when shooting in 24p mode - hence not requiring 3:2 pulldown removal, while to the best of my knowledge that option has not yet been added to the EX3 (which always outputs in 60i mode)
